The names of past champions are familiar: Lorena Ochoa, Amy Alcott, John Cook, Jason Day, Ernie Els, Anthony Kim, Billy Mayfair, Phil Mickelson, Corey Pavin, Craig Stadler, and six-time champion Tiger Woods.
Woods' record at Torrey Pines is often cited: 8 PGA Tour victories, including the 2008 U.S. Open. But his Junior World win at Torrey Pines in 1991 was also notable, as he became the first 15-year-old to win the 15-17 age division championship (it's 15-18 now), edging out fellow future PGA Tour member Chris Riley in the final round.
In 1984, Ernie Els won the 13-14 age division at Balboa Park by three shots over Phil Mickelson. Twenty years later, Mickelson would deny Els the Masters title with the memorable birdie putt on the 72nd hole at Augusta National that gave Mickelson his first major win.
